引言
Git是一款强大的分布式版本控制系统,它可以帮助开发者更好地管理代码,协同工作,并确保代码的版本控制。在Git的使用过程中,更新本地代码是一个基础且重要的操作。本文将详细介绍如何高效地更新本地代码,确保你的工作副本与远程仓库保持同步。
更新本地代码的步骤
1. 确认远程仓库
在更新本地代码之前,首先需要确认你要更新的远程仓库。你可以使用以下命令查看当前已经关联的远程仓库:
git remote -v
如果还没有关联远程仓库,可以使用以下命令添加远程仓库:
git remote add origin [远程仓库地址]
2. 拉取最新代码
确认了远程仓库后,使用以下命令拉取最新的代码到本地:
git pull origin [分支名]
这个命令会自动合并远程仓库的代码和本地代码,并将最新的代码更新到本地。
3. 处理冲突
在拉取最新代码的过程中,可能会出现冲突的情况。冲突指的是远程仓库和本地仓库对同一行代码进行了不同的修改,Git无法自动合并这些修改。当出现冲突时,Git会在冲突的文件中标记出冲突的位置,需要手动解决冲突。
解决冲突的方法有两种:
手动修改冲突的文件:将冲突的代码修改为你想要的内容。
使用命令git mergetool:这个命令会打开一个图形化的工具来帮助你解决冲突。
4. 提交更新
在解决完冲突之后,提交更新到本地仓库:
git add .
git commit -m "更新说明"
这样,更新就成功地保存到本地仓库了。
5. 推送更新(可选)
如果你想要将更新推送到远程仓库,可以使用以下命令:
git push
这将把本地仓库的更改推送到远程仓库。
实例操作
以下是一个更新本地代码的实例操作:
# 查看远程仓库
git remote -v
# 添加远程仓库
git remote add origin [远程仓库地址]
# 拉取最新代码
git pull origin master
# 解决冲突(如果有)
# 提交更新
git add .
git commit -m "更新说明"
# 推送更新
git push
总结
通过以上步骤,你可以高效地更新本地代码,确保你的工作副本与远程仓库保持同步。记住,定期更新代码是一个良好的习惯,它可以帮助你避免冲突和解决问题。